Resumo
In this paper we present an independent scheme for constructing fractional parentage coefficients using symmetry group apparatus in translationally invariantmodel space, suitable for the six-particle system composed of three-particle bi-clusters, where the presented subsystems have their own intrinsic clusterization. Simple expressions for corresponding antisymmetrization procedure are presented as well as computational results.
